Attempt #2 at adding BazelContext to the Label constructor.
The first attempt broke rules_closure in CI, which was fixed by unknown commit.
RELNOTES: None
PiperOrigin-RevId: 229307422
diff --git a/src/main/java/com/google/devtools/build/skydoc/fakebuildapi/FakeSkylarkRuleFunctionsApi.java b/src/main/java/com/google/devtools/build/skydoc/fakebuildapi/FakeSkylarkRuleFunctionsApi.java
index 90260c1..9690686 100644
--- a/src/main/java/com/google/devtools/build/skydoc/fakebuildapi/FakeSkylarkRuleFunctionsApi.java
+++ b/src/main/java/com/google/devtools/build/skydoc/fakebuildapi/FakeSkylarkRuleFunctionsApi.java
@@ -149,8 +149,13 @@
}
@Override
- public Label label(String labelString, Boolean relativeToCallerRepository, Location loc,
- Environment env) throws EvalException {
+ public Label label(
+ String labelString,
+ Boolean relativeToCallerRepository,
+ Location loc,
+ Environment env,
+ StarlarkContext context)
+ throws EvalException {
try {
return Label.parseAbsolute(
labelString,